  1. Berkeley Harris was born on 17 January 1933 in Hamlet, North Carolina, USA. He was an actor, known for Shenandoah (1965), Bullet for a Badman (1964) and Bob Hope Presents the Chrysler Theatre (1963). He was married to Beverlee McKinsey and Susan Harris.

    He is the son of the late actor Berkeley Harris, who appeared mainly in Western films, and television writer and producer Susan Harris (née Spivak), who created Soap and The Golden Girls, among other series.
